What's New in ChatGPT 5 Agent Mode

ChatGPT 5's Agent mode represents a significant evolution in AI capability, enabling the system to function as an autonomous assistant rather than simply a conversational partner. Unlike standard chatbot interactions where each exchange is largely isolated, Agent mode allows ChatGPT to maintain focus on complex tasks across multiple conversation turns, remembering context and working toward specific goals with minimal supervision. The agent leverages powerful built-in tools including a Python interpreter for data analysis, a web browser for real-time research, and DALL-E for image generation. Most impressively, it can interact with authenticated user systems like Google Calendar or email after appropriate permissions, enabling it to schedule meetings, organize information, and even generate complete work products like spreadsheets, reports, and presentations. As the agent works, it provides real-time narration of its actions, maintaining transparency while allowing users to interrupt or redirect at any point—ensuring humans remain firmly in control of the process while benefiting from unprecedented automation.

Why This Matters for Businesses

The business implications of truly autonomous AI assistants cannot be overstated. First, there's the productivity angle—Agent mode can handle time-consuming tasks that previously required human attention, from market research and lead generation to data analysis and report creation. Organizations can now automate entire workflows that were previously impossible to delegate to machines. For example, a marketing team could instruct the agent to research competitors, analyze social media performance, draft content suggestions, and compile everything into a presentation—all as a single instruction. The agent's ability to schedule recurring tasks adds another dimension, enabling consistent execution of regular reports or analyses without manual prompting. For UAE businesses competing in a global marketplace, this means the ability to operate more efficiently across time zones, with AI agents preparing materials while human teams are offline. Beyond productivity, there's strategic value in having an AI that can rapidly integrate internal company data with public information, producing insights that might otherwise require expensive consultants or dedicated analyst teams. For enterprise users, ChatGPT 5 addresses security concerns with robust governance features, including role-based access controls, website blocking capabilities, and comprehensive activity logging—essential for regulated industries and data-sensitive operations.
